  "textContent": "\n\n\nThe BBC’s broadcast of this year’s Eurovision Song Contest 2026 final attracted just 5.2 million viewers, marking the competition’s smallest audience in more than 15 years.\n\nAccording to Eurovision fansite Eurovoix, the figure represents a drop of 1.49 million viewers compared with 2025, when 6.7 million people tuned in to watch the annual contest.\n\n###\n\n\n\n\nThe semi-finals performed even more poorly, with audiences of around 1.3 million and 1.2 million for the Tuesday and Thursday broadcasts, respectively.\n\nThe figures reflect live viewing only and do not include streaming audiences.\n\n###\n\n\n\n\nTRENDING\n\nStories\n\nVideos\n\nYour Say\n\n###\n\n\n\n\nThe UK was not alone in experiencing falling interest, with Sweden and France also reporting significant declines in Eurovision audiences this year.\n\nBritain’s representative, Look Mum No Computer, whose real name is Sam Battle, finished bottom of the leaderboard.\n\nHis original song, Eins, Zwei, Drei, received just one point from Ukraine’s jury, while the public vote awarded the act nothing at all.\n\nIt marks the third consecutive year the UK’s Eurovision entry has failed to secure any televote support.\n\n###\n\n\n\n\n###\n\n\n\n\n###\n\n\n\n\nThe United Kingdom has now finished last six times since 2000, including Saturday's result.\n\nReflecting on the outcome in a post on Instagram, Mr Battle wrote: “Bulgaria honestly deserved [the] winner!
